Required supplies:
• Crochet hooks (I recommend Size "J" or "6.00mm" for beginners)
• Worsted/Medium weight acrylic yarn. (Avoid dark colors like black and fuzzy yarns for beginners, as they can be difficult to work with.)
• Scissors
Additional supplies:
If your learner is ready to progress to more advanced projects, some of the following supplies may be useful to have:
• Yarn needles (For weaving in ends and attaching pieces)
• Long, ball-head sewing pins (For holding pieces in place while they are being attached)
• Polyester fiberfill (for stuffed toys and pillows)
• Plastic safety eyes for stuffed toys
• Stitch markers (For making it easier to count stitches and do complex patterns)
• Crochet hook organizer (For keeping hooks in an organized space where they are easy to find)
